One of the most valuable resources to designers are, of course, textures. Whether free textures or commercial stock textures, the more you have, the more design possibilities you have at your disposal and you can use them for practically anything. I personally have hundreds (possibly thousands) of textures that I've downloaded or made myself. Due to the massive amount of image files involved, I once again looked to the useful new libraries feature in Windows 7 to help me keep track of all texture files. But, of course, I had to keep it organized and give it an icon of its own. Since the dA community is melting pot of all kinds of artists, I thought other people might like to add this icon to their collection. It also serves as a decent Pictures library icon too, so use it however you'd like. Enjoy!I'd like to especially thank milanioom for his awesome work on the my pictures icon and for graciously allowing me to create a library icon out of it.
